Rhomboid Major and Minor Trigger Points
Introduction
The rhomboid major and minor are key upper back muscles responsible for scapular retraction, posture support, and shoulder stability. When trigger points develop in these muscles, they can cause upper back pain, shoulder blade tightness, and postural discomfort, often mimicking trapezius strain, rotator cuff dysfunction, or cervical spine issues.
Name and Area
Name: Rhomboid Major and Rhomboid Minor
Area: Located in the upper back, running from the thoracic vertebrae (T2–T5) and cervical vertebrae (C7–T1) to the medial border of the scapula.

Muscle Action
Retracts the Scapula: Pulls the shoulder blades toward the spine, essential for posture and shoulder stability.
Elevates the Scapula: Assists in lifting the shoulder blade.
Stabilizes the Shoulder Blade: Works with other scapular muscles to support upper body movements.
The rhomboids are crucial for postural support, scapular mechanics, and upper back function.

Trigger Point Referral Pattern
Trigger points in the rhomboids refer pain to:
The space between the shoulder blades (Can Mimic Trapezius Strain or Upper Back Tightness)
The upper shoulder and medial arm (Mistaken for Rotator Cuff or Shoulder Dysfunction)
The thoracic spine (Can Resemble Poor Posture-Related Pain or Rib Dysfunction)
Pain from this muscle is often confused with cervical radiculopathy, upper trapezius strain, or thoracic outlet syndrome.

Anatomy and Innervation
Muscle | Origin | Insertion | Innervation |
---|---|---|---|
Rhomboid Major | Spinous processes of T2–T5 | Medial border of the scapula | Dorsal scapular nerve (C4–C5) |
Rhomboid Minor | Spinous processes of C7–T1 | Medial border of the scapula (superior to rhomboid major) | Dorsal scapular nerve (C4–C5) |
The rhomboids are innervated by the dorsal scapular nerve (C4–C5), which also controls scapular movement and upper back stabilization.
Patient Examination
A comprehensive examination should include:
Palpation: Identify tender nodules along the upper back and medial scapular border.
Resisted Scapular Retraction Testing: Assess pain and weakness when pulling the shoulder blades together against resistance.
Postural Analysis: Look for forward shoulders, rounded upper back, or excessive thoracic kyphosis.
Scapular Mobility Testing: Rule out scapular winging or movement dysfunction.
Corrective Actions
Dry Needling
Dry needling can release trigger points in the rhomboids, reducing upper back tightness and improving scapular mobility.
Manual Therapy
Trigger Point Release: Apply deep sustained pressure to tight spots along the medial scapular border.
Massage Therapy: Helps improve circulation and reduce upper back muscle tension.
Stretching
Cross-Body Shoulder Stretch: Helps release tension in the rhomboids and upper back.
Foam Roller Thoracic Stretch: Improves thoracic spine mobility and scapular alignment.
Strengthening Exercises
Scapular Retraction Drills (Band Pull-Aparts): Strengthens the rhomboids and improves shoulder posture.
Face Pulls: Encourages proper scapular control and prevents excessive forward shoulder posture.
Wall Angels: Improves thoracic mobility and postural stability.
